Childcare injury incidents total 3,422

There were 3,422 incidents last year in which children in care or their carers were injured. These included 784 cases where medical attention or first aid was required.

More injuries to both young people in care and to staff occurred because of incidents, rather than accidents, but children are more likely to come to harm than their carers.

The data, released under Freedom of Information, is split into three categories: special care, in which a small number of young people are placed each year; Tusla or voluntary placements; and private centres.
